Inner rings should be used with spiral wound gaskets on male-and-female flanges, such as those found in heat-exchanger, shell, channel, and cover-flange joints. Spiral wound ring gaskets are also used in tongue-and-groove flanges. When used in this type of flanges there will be no inner and outer metal rings as gasket are fit inside the groove

Shell approved Spiral Wound Finned tubes, Integral Finned tubes, Process Spiral Wound Finned Tube Fins are basically external surfaces on tube for increasing the surface area of the bare tube, resulting in a compact Heat Exchanger. The method of attaching the fins over tube is of prime importance, since even a slightest air gap between the tube and fins will defeat the whole purpose of fins over the tube.
